Double superconducting transition in the filled skutterudite PrOs4Sb12 and sample characterizations
A thorough characterization of many samples of the filled skutterudite
compound PrOs4Sb12 is provided. We find that the double superconducting
transition in the specific heat Tc1~1.89K and Tc2~1.72K tends to appear in
samples with a large residual resistivity ratio, large specific heat jump at
the superconducting transition and with the highest absolute value of the
specific heat above Tc1. However, we present evidence which casts doubt on the
intrinsic nature of the double superconducting transition. The ratio of the two
specific heat jumps \Delta C(Tc1)/\Delta C(Tc2) shows a wide range of values on
crystals from different batches but also within the same batch. This ratio was
strongly reduced by polishing a sample down to 120um. Remarkably, three samples
exhibit a single sharp transition of ~15mK in width at Tc~1.7K. The normalized
specific heat jump (C-Cnormal)/Cnormal at Tc of two of them is higher than ~32%
so larger than the sum of the two specific heat jumps when a double transition
exists. As an evidence of better quality, the slope in the transition is at
least two time steeper.
We discuss the origins of the double transition; in particular we consider,
based on X-ray diffraction results, a scenario involving Pr-vacancies. The
superconducting phase diagram under magnetic field of a sample with a single
transition is fitted with a two-band model taking into account the good values
for the gap as deduced from thermal conductivity measurements.Comment: 10 pages, 9 figures, 2 tables, submitted to Physical review
Corporate networks in Poland: interlocking directorates and business systems
A Work Project, presented as part of the requirements for the Award of a Masters Degree in Management from the NOVA – School of Business and EconomicsAiming at filling a gap in the literature, which has been concentrated on USA and Western-European Countries, this paper analyzes the Polish corporate network based on interlocking directorates among 125 top companies in the country. To determine the characteristics of the network and its implications for the business system the exploratory Social Network Analysis is conducted. It is found that the Polish network is fragmented and the interlocks appear mainly along companies from financial and chemical sectors. Basing on comparison with Germany it is suggested that the Polish network will be growing in size and density in the future
How the Grateful Dead Turned Alternative Business and Legal Strategies Into A Great American Success Story
That the Grateful Dead were different undoubtedly is true on a broad social level. But it is not so easy to ascertain how they were different in the business and legal aspects of their enterprise. The ephemeral nature of their approach stems from the fact that they conducted their affairs within and alongside the world of statutes and contracts and yet provided themselves with a great degree of independence from that world. This Note will comment on the Dead\u27s perspective on and their ultimate rejection of many of the business and legal strategies traditionally ascribed to in the industry. After a brief introduction to the ethos of the Grateful Dead--essential as a frame of reference into their collective character--this Note will provide summaries of common music industry practices involved in signing onto a recording label and getting one\u27s material marketed, distributed, and sold. It will then examine the law that protects exposure of artists and their work. The reader should keep in mind that the law views songwriters and recording artists as separate entities. In practice, this distinction applies in most instances. This Note, however, will assume that these parties are one and the same, partly because the Dead both wrote and recorded their material, and partly to avoid the inconvenience and redundancy of having to draw out this distinction in passim
Galanin modulates oxytocin release from rat hypothalamo-neurohypophysial explant in vitro — the role of acute or prolonged osmotic stimulus

bodziec osmotyczny blokuje wrażliwość neuronów OT-ergicznych na działanie galaniny. (Endokrynol Pol 2013; 64 (2): 139–148)Introduction: Galanin (Gal) may be involved as the neuromodulator of different processes in the central nervous system in the regulation
of neurohypophysial function. The aim of the present study was to examine the influence of Gal on oxytocin (OT) release in vitro: an acute
or prolonged osmotic stimulus was used as the stimulatory agent.
Material and methods: Experiments were carried out on three-month old male rats which acted as donors of isolated rat hypothalamus
(Hth), neurohypophysis (NH) or hypothalamo-neurohypophysial explants (Hth-NH). The effect of Gal on OT secretion was studied under
conditions of non-osmotic (i.e. K+-evoked) (series 1), direct osmotic (i.e. Na+-evoked) (series 2) or indirect osmotic stimulation (series 3;
neural tissues were obtained from animals drinking 2% NaCl). OT content was determined by radioimmunoassay.
Results: Galanin added into incubative media caused the inhibition of basal OT release from NH and Hth-NH explants prepared from
euhydrated rats but stimulated basal and K+-stimulated OT release from the Hth tissue. Gal did not exert any influence on Na+-evoked
OT secretion. We observed increased basal OT secretion from NH and K+-evoked respective OT release from Hth and Hth-NH explants
taken from osmotically challenged rats under the influence of Gal.
Conclusions: Present experiments in vitro show that:
1. Galanin plays the role of an inhibitory neuromodulator of OT release from the neurohypophysis; its effect is opposite at the hypothalamic
level.
2. Galanin acts as the stimulatory neuromodulator of OT release in response to prolonged osmotic stimulus; an acute osmotic stimulus
blocks OT-ergic neurons susceptible to Gal. (Endokrynol Pol 2013; 64 (2): 139–148
Space Law and Space Mining, Exploring New Horizons Amid COVID-19 Pandemic
This study analyses the current scenario with COVID-19 affecting the international and Thai space law, and its impacts and corresponding repercussions upon the Thai economy, ASEAN region and then at international level. The methodology adopted for this study is a mixed method with qualitative research tools collected from key informant interviews and focus group discussions. The data analysis involves the Strength, Weakness, Opportunity, and Threat (SWOT) analysis, which has been integrated with Hierarchical Thematic areas to provide the supporting model for wholesome recommendations through analyzing the findings from the research. The key respondents involved several government officials associated with Thai space agencies and departments, along with judges, lawyers, researchers, academicians, non-government organizations (NGO) officials, and law students. The findings provided the need for adoption of Treaty leading to the creation of a space organization which would be accountable towards setting up a legal framework for commencement of space mining operations. The international space tribunal is to be created under this international space organization to resolve any disputes arising out of space mining. The overall implications of this research would lead to the sharing of the benefits of space mining with both developed and developing countries to enhance sustainable development for all mankind. Association between the ACE I/D polymorphism and physical activity in Polish women
Angiotensin converting enzyme gene (ACE) is the most
frequently investigated genetic marker in the context of genetic
conditioning of athletic predispositions. However, the knowledge
of ACE\u2019s potential modifying effect on changes in selected body
traits achieved through a training programme is still limited.
Therefore, we have decided to check whether selected body
mass, body composition variables, oxygen uptake parameters as
well as strength/speed parameters observed in physically active
participants will be modulated by the ACE I/D polymorphism.
The genotype distribution was examined in a group of 201
young healthy women measured for chosen traits before and
after the completion of a 12-week moderate-intensive aerobic
training programme. Our results revealed the significant
genotype
7 training interactions for VEmax and power of
countermovement jump, whereas training improvements
were demonstrated for almost all parameters. In addition,
main effects of the ACE I/D genotype on TGL, HDL, glucose
and 10 m run were observed. A significant increase in VEmax
was demonstrated for II and DD genotypes, but not for ID
heterozygotes. The greatest gain in power of countermovement
jump was observed in II homozygotes, although DD and ID
were associated with a significant increase as well. Our study
indicated that the polymorphism was associated with changes
in VEmax and power of countermovement jump in response to
a 12-week aerobic training programme in Caucasian women.
